Husam M. Younes is a scholar working on Biomaterials, Biomedical Engineering and Immunology. According to data from OpenAlex, Husam M. Younes has authored 24 papers receiving a total of 589 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Biomaterials, 10 papers in Biomedical Engineering and 4 papers in Immunology. Recurrent topics in Husam M. Younes’s work include Electrospun Nanofibers in Biomedical Applications (8 papers), biodegradable polymer synthesis and properties (7 papers) and 3D Printing in Biomedical Research (4 papers). Husam M. Younes is often cited by papers focused on Electrospun Nanofibers in Biomedical Applications (8 papers), biodegradable polymer synthesis and properties (7 papers) and 3D Printing in Biomedical Research (4 papers). Husam M. Younes collaborates with scholars based in Qatar, Canada and United Kingdom. Husam M. Younes's co-authors include Brian G. Amsden, Mohamed A. Shaker, Frank Gu, Gauri P. Misra, Abdelbary Elhissi, Ayman O.S. El‐Kadi, Ronald J. Neufeld, Jules J.E. Doré, Mohamed A. Elrayess and Somayeh Zamani and has published in prestigious journals such as Biomaterials, Journal of Controlled Release and Biomacromolecules.
